Ultrasonic flowmeter

April 3, 2006
The Series DFX flowmeter, a Doppler ultrasonic flowmeter from Dynasonics, features intelligent software algorithms that monitor incoming signal quality and flowmeter performance and make automatic adjustments to nullify changing liquid conditions.

Monitoring system

April 3, 2006
PBI-Dansensor's checkpoint monitoring systems monitor carbon monoxide (CO) gas in modified atmosphere packaging (MAP) to meet color appeal, product stability and consumer demands for visibly fresh red meat.

Produce tray former

April 3, 2006
Pearson's Model H380 compact, self-contained tray former automatically forms and seals open-top, side-laminated trays at rates up to 38 trays per minute. As the blanks move through the pick motion, the first folding sequence occurs.
